1:1 Joshua (a-19) Meaning 'Jehovah [is] Saviour.' see Numbers 13:16 .

Verse 2

11:2 Chinneroth, (a-17) Gennesaret. west, (b-30) Lit 'the sea.'

Verse 4

11:4 armies (c-9) Or 'camps.'

Verse 6

11:6 slain (d-23) Lit. 'pierced through.'

Verse 8

11:8 valley (e-26) Wide valley or plain surrounded by heights. so ver. 17.

Verse 13

11:13 hills (f-10) Or 'mounds.' see Jeremiah 30:18 .

Verse 14

11:14 men (g-25) Lit. 'The Adam' -- man as a race.

Verse 15

11:15 nothing (h-19) Or 'not a word.'

Verse 16

11:16 south, (i-12) The Negeb . see ch. 10.40 lowland, (k-21) The Shephelah . see ch. 9.1; Deuteronomy 1:7 . plain, (l-24) The Arabah . so ch. 12.8, &c.. see ch. 3.16.

Verse 17

11:17 mountain, (a-4) Or 'Mount Halak.'

Verse 21

11:21 mountains, (b-14) mountain (b-25) mountain (b-32) Or 'hill-country.'
